The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48:
Bedfellow \Bed"fel`low\, n.
One who lies with another in the same bed; a person who
shares one's couch.

WordNet (r) 3.0 (2006):
bedfellow
n 1: a temporary associate; "politics makes strange bedfellows"
2: a person with whom you share a bed
